Georgia’s Best-Kept Secret: Little St. Simons Island

Advertisement

Advertisement

Little St. Simons Island is one of the most exclusive private islands in the United States. Little St. Simons Island is a private island where guests enjoy peace and privacy and experience eco-luxury. Little St. Simons Island is in the Golden Isles of Georgia and covers 11,000 acres of conservation land. Little St. Simons Island is designed to help guests enjoy the beautiful surrounding nature. Guests will need to take a boat to reach this island and stay at an eco-lodge. There is no place in the world where you can get this experience.

Daufuskie Island: South Carolina’s Best-Kept Secret

Advertisement

Advertisement

Daufuskie Island is the perfect retreat for travelers who want to get away from the more populated tourist locations. This island is only accessible by boat, making it more private. The island offers Gullah culture, empty stretches of coastline, and historic sites, including a lighthouse. The island offers rental houses and provides a wonderful setting for guests to enjoy a relaxed, refined beach experience. This island offers a slower pace and a sense of oneness with nature and culture.

Texas Hill Country & Fredericksburg: Where Wine, Dine, & Unwind

With Fredericksburg at its center, the Texas Hill Country is quickly becoming a premium destination for high-end travelers. This beautiful town has German roots and features elegant boutique hotels, first-class dining, and wineries. Additionally, many wine estates offer unique boutique tasting experiences. Hill Country’s boutique inns and resorts offer their guests a more relaxed atmosphere and a slower pace. This region is emerging as an ideal destination for fine wine, gourmet dining, and relaxation, all set against a stunning natural backdrop.

Leavenworth and North Bend: Europe-Inspired Resorts

If you’re interested in a raised outdoor experience with European vibes, check out Leavenworth and North Bend in Washington. Leavenworth is home to transitory boutique lodges and streets with Bavarian-inspired buildings, and serves up European alpine experiences in the PNW. North Bend- where the rainforest foothills meet the lavish luxury lodges in lush greenery- provides the perfect combination for those looking to indulge in the great outdoors. This is a combination of luxuriously cozy and natural experiences, perfect for a little getaway

Sedona: Arizona’s Gem among the Red Rocks

Despite being the most luxurious and understated destination in the United States, Sedona is a gem of a place. Well-known for its red-rock formations, vortex landscapes, and luxury wellness resorts, Sedona offers spas and wellness retreats throughout its landscape. The high-end accommodation allows you to rejuvenate and heal in nature, all while providing a perfect blend of spiritual healing and world-class amenities. This destination offers an enriching experience while helping recharge and heal the body, mind, and soul. It is an exceedingly awe-inspiring location.

Northern New Mexico: A New Kind of Luxury

Northern New Mexico is home to the artistic towns of Santa Fe and Taos. Here, you will find luxury haciendas and boutique wellness centres. You will also find a rich cultural heritage, including art galleries, museums, and festivals. The natural beauty, combined with the area’s artistic and cultural elements, makes it a fine destination for luxury travelers. The warm, peaceful atmosphere and rich cultural offerings give the area a unique advantage as a luxury destination for travelers.
